The actuarial loss occurred principally because the investment returns on the assets of the WHX Pension Plan have been lower than the actuarial assumptions.

In addition to its pension plans which are included in the table above, the Company also maintains several other post-retirement benefit plans covering certain of its employees and retirees.  The approximate aggregate expense for these plans was $0.5 million and $0.4 million for the three month periods ended September 30, 2011 and 2010, respectively, and $1.6 million and $1.3 million for the nine month periods ended September 30, 2011 and 2010, respectively.  In addition, during the nine months ended September 30, 2010, the Company reduced its postretirement benefits expense by $0.7 million because of reductions in certain post-retirement benefits for former employees.
